Power Plant Control System Market Overview

Power Plant Control System Market (USD Million)

Power Plant Control System Market was valued at USD 8,384.41 million in the year 2024.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 10,885.63 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 3.8%.

The Power Plant Control System Market is emerging as a cornerstone in modern energy operations, driving efficiency, safety, and reliability across generation facilities. By incorporating advanced automation technologies, these systems regulate and monitor critical processes to maximize performance. Over 65% of plants have shifted toward digitalized control platforms, reflecting the industry’s emphasis on modernization and intelligent energy management.

Innovative Technologies
Continuous advancements in AI, IoT, and automation are redefining control system capabilities. More than half of installed systems now include predictive analytics and remote monitoring to optimize plant operations and minimize downtime. These innovations strengthen adaptability, enabling facilities to respond effectively to fluctuating energy demands while boosting overall productivity.

Operational Safety and Efficiency
A growing number of operators are turning to control systems for enhanced operational safety and fuel efficiency. Real-time monitoring and predictive insights have helped reduce risks by more than 40%, while supporting optimized fuel consumption. The ability to anticipate failures before they occur is positioning these systems as essential tools for sustainable and safe energy generation.

Rising Digital Adoption
The expansion of digital platforms and automated solutions has become a defining trend, with over 55% of modern systems integrated into centralized networks. Automation has lowered manual tasks by nearly 35%, allowing for seamless grid management and renewable energy incorporation. This digital shift is delivering greater precision, agility, and reliability in power plant operations.
